Jingle All the Way

Jingle All the Way by Erin Lanter, published by Liberties Journal Foundation on October 28, 2024, is a cozy mystery that unfolds in the charming town of Saddle Hill during the holiday season. The story centers around Marian Bright, who has recently opened a bed and breakfast, the Farmhouse Inn, providing a welcoming retreat for both locals and visitors. When a jewel thief targets the inn during an ice storm, the local sheriff and his deputy initially believe they have the case solved, but further thefts prompt a deeper investigation into the suspects.
Readers will find a blend of suspense and community spirit as the residents of Saddle Hill unite to uncover the truth behind the crimes. The narrative explores themes of friendship and resilience amidst challenging circumstances, showcasing the determination of amateur sleuths to clear the name of one of their own. With 258 pages, this edition invites readers into a world where mystery and holiday cheer intertwine, making it a fitting addition to the cozy mystery genre.

Crime visits Saddle Hill once again when a jewel thief comes to town for the holidays.
After being kidnapped last year a few days before Christmas, Marian Bright has found a new passion: her recently opened bed and breakfast. Offering a retreat for locals and out-of-towners alike, the Farmhouse Inn Bed & Breakfast provides a warm welcome to all.
When an ice storm hits and leaves everyone stranded, a jewel thief jumps at the chance to relieve one of the guests of their gems. Sheriff Joe Adler and Deputy Eli Nolan believe they have the mystery solved, but when another theft occurs, they realize they’ll have to take another look at the suspects.
Despite the treacherous weather conditions, the Saddle Hill locals must band together to solve the crime – and clear the name of one of their own.
